Innovative Research in Metal Extraction. Recent research led by Professor Timo Repo of the Catalysis and Green Chemistry research group has been published in the journal Angewandte Chemie. The article introduces a three-stage process where copper is first dissolved from electronic waste, followed by silver and, finally, gold.

Gold processing - Refining, Smelting, Purifying: Gold extracted by amalgamation or cyanidation contains a variety of impurities, including zinc, copper, silver, and iron. Two methods are commonly employed for purification: the Miller process and the Wohlwill process. The Miller process is based on the fact that virtually all the impurities present in …

Researchers at University of Saskatchewan in Canada have found a cheap, fast, and environmentally-friendly way to extract gold from materials while producing re-usable waste — a technology that might …
The original method of extracting aluminium involved the reduction of aluminium chloride using the reactive metal sodium. Aluminium obtained by this method was very expensive due to the high cost of extracting sodium from sodium chloride.
